Transponder Codes

When a transponder gets interrogated it sends out an encoded signal with an eight-digit code. This signal is known as a SQUAWK code and it is the basis for identifying aircraft on radar screens. It can also be used to transmit specific messages to air traffic control in the case of an emergency or to alert air traffic controllers to changes in weather conditions. Squawk codes can be used to communicate with ATC when the pilot is unable communicate via radio. They are vital to ensure safe flying.

Every aircraft is equipped with a transponder that responds to radar interrogation by identifying a code. This enables ATC to locate an aircraft on a busy screen. Transponders come in a variety of modes that vary how they respond to interrogation. Mode A only transmits the code, while mode C includes data on altitude. Mode S transponders provide more detailed information like call signs and location which are useful in airspace that is crowded.

Most aircraft have a small beige-colored box beneath the seat of the pilot. The transponder is a tiny beige box that is used to transmit the SQUAWK code when air traffic control system activates the aircraft. The transponder can be set to the 'ON', the ALT, or the SBY (standby position) positions.

It's not uncommon to hear a pilot told by air traffic control to "squawk ident". This is a command for the pilot to hit the IDENT button on their transponder. The ident button causes the aircraft blink on ATC radar screens, allowing them to easily identify your aircraft on the screen.

There are 63 distinct code blocks that can be assigned to an aircraft. However, there are reserved codes which prevent the use of certain codes in areas with high traffic or in times of emergency. The block configuration of the discrete code is based on statistical analysis in order to reduce the likelihood of two aircraft with identical SQUAWK code being in the same area.

PIN codes

A PIN code is a set of numbers (usually six or four digits) that are used to access an item or system. A smart phone, as an instance, comes with PIN numbers that users must enter every time they use the device. PIN codes are used to safeguard ATM and transactions at POS[1], secure access control (doors computers, cars),[2] and internet transactions.

While a longer PIN code might appear to be more secure, there are ways to hack or guess the PIN code as short as four digits. It is recommended that the PIN must be at minimum six digits in length, with a mix of letters and numbers, to give more security.
